The GE Mark V turbine control platform was introduced in the 1980s and remained in widespread deployment through the 2000s. GE officially discontinued Mark V support, and the Mark VI, while more recent, is itself approaching end-of-active-support status in many configurations. Thousands of turbine units worldwide — in power generation, oil & gas, and petrochemical facilities — continue to run on these platforms because the cost and operational risk of a full control system upgrade is prohibitive.
